Abstract
The present study deals flexural analysis of cross ply laminated beams subjected to combined thermal load and transverse mechanical load. The trigonometric, hyperbolic and 5th order shear deformation theories are used. These theories do not need the shear correction factor and satisfy the stress free condition at top and bottom of the beam. The equilibrium equations are used to find transverse shear stresses. The development of governing equations are done by using principle of virtual work. The stresses and displacements are investigated under uniformly distributed nonlinear thermal load in combination with uniformly distributed transverse mechanical load. The results obtained by these theories are compared with each other since the exact solutions are not available for these problems.
